The Diamond Long Legs is an arachnorb miniboss in Pikmin 4 (Wii U). It is the rarest arachnorb encountered, appearing only once in Silver Lake, and in two caves, Chaotic Cove and Spider's Web. At Silver Lake it is located in a snowy arena to the east of the landing site, where there are gems arranged into the shape of a web. Rock Pikmin are recommended to fight the creature with as it has a covering made of diamond. When defeated there, it drops the Snow Parka.

The Diamond Long Legs can not be fought without using Rock Pikmin, which are immune to being crushed and stabbed, only making them more useful against the creature. To defeat it, simply throw Rock Pikmin at its protected core until its crystal coating shatters and then hit the main body to inflict damage to the boss. Whenever its armor is broken, shards of it will come crashing down to the ground, impaling any Pikmin unfortunate enough to be under them as they land. The coating will eventually reform and must be broken again.

In Pikmin IV, the Diamond Long Legs is a somewhat common arachnorb species. It moves incredibly slowly, and much like in Pikmin 4 (Wii U), hitting its crystal armor until it breaks will reveal its vulnerable main body but allow the creature to move much faster. Breaking the bits of crystal on the boss's joints will deal a fair bit of damage to it. When defeated, the Diamond Long Legs will roar, stiffen up, drop whatever it was holding, and then completely shatter. The crystal shards will knock down Pikmin and leaders they land on but are otherwise harmless.

Diamond Long Legs is an arachnorb miniboss in Pikmin: Treacherous Treasures. It can only attack by stomping slowly about and crushing Pikmin under its large, clawed feet. Its metallic blue torso is protected by a large diamond, much like how its joints are protected by crystal beads, necessitating the use of Rock Pikmin to defeat the creature. Once its diamond or at least some of its beads are destroyed, the Diamond Long Legs moves much faster; furthermore, the creature sustains damage for every destroyed bead, and when its diamond is destroyed, it suspends its torso high enough off the ground that only thrown Yellow Pikmin can reach it. When defeated, it disintegrates into sparkling dust, and the crystal fragments can be retrieved for Pokos. Although extremely challenging, it is possible to defeat a Diamond Long Legs without destroying its diamond shell by simply targeting the beads around its joints; destroying them all will kill the creature, leaving its diamond intact and yielding many more Pokos than its fragments.
